Camp Krietenstein Dining Room Renovation
R.E. Dimond and Associates were part of the team that designed a new dining facility to replace an older dining hall which was built in 1934 at the Boy Scouts of America’s Camp Krietenstein. Located near Poland, Indiana, Camp Krietenstein’s acres is nestled in 177 acres of scenic Indiana hardwood forest. In addition to the dining area, the new facility acts as home for camp offices and a medical bay. R.E. Dimond was responsible for the electrical power and lighting, HVAC, and plumbing system design.
